chryseobacterium lineare sp. nov., isolated from a limpid stream. | a gram-strain-negative, aerobic, non-motile, rod-shaped, yellow-pigmented bacterial strain, xc0022t, isolated from freshwater of a limpid stream in zhejiang, china, was studied using a polyphasic approach. the phylogenetic analysis based on 16s rrna gene sequences clearly showed an allocation to the genus chryseobacterium with the highest sequence similarities of 98.0 % to chryseobacterium taeanense pha3-4t, 97.2 % to c. taihuense thmbm1t, 97.1 % to c. rigui cj16t and 97.1 % to c. profundimaris ... | 2016 | 27902240 |
